Output d76be186b280736b5a542a6700c30e97ea484c3c78adb0c016588cfe96801711:0

value
374670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b0c8e208a0436625ec8f643f4c0705d12028c0 OP_EQUAL
address
3A3qCDWijMM4X41akDneUnD47Tt9UtHdwx
transaction
d76be186b280736b5a542a6700c30e97ea484c3c78adb0c016588cfe96801711
spent
true